Arrived early at 11:30am, to a foggy and overcast day. Showers predicted, but the sun peeks out occasionally. Canal tour this avo then disembark tomorrow at 9am.

Quick stroll around the red light district last night. The girls seemed a little prettier and less bored, than I recall from previous visits.

Now the 9th. Met up with Jan and Tessa this morning, ran a couple of errands with them and came back to their house on a canal for morning tea. Then Rob and I caught a tram to the museum square: visited Van Gogh, a diamond house and Rembrandt's House. Then a long, leisurely walk home. Special home dinner tonight, rijsttafel tomorrow night and Japanese the night after.
